Zookeeper常见面试题TOP20:大数据开发者必备

Zookeeper常见面试题TOP20:大数据开发者必知的核心考点与实战解析

关键词

Zookeeper | 分布式协调 | watch机制 | ZAB协议 | 集群架构 | 节点类型 | CAP理论

摘要

在大数据生态中,Zookeeper就像“分布式系统的协调中枢”,支撑着Hadoop、Spark、Kafka等核心组件的高可用与一致性。对于大数据开发者来说,掌握Zookeeper的核心原理不仅是面试必备,更是解决实际分布式问题的关键。本文梳理了Zookeeper常见面试题TOP20,从基础概念(节点类型、CAP模型)到底层原理(ZAB协议、选举过程),再到实战问题(watch一次性、集群扩容),逐一深入解析。通过生活化比喻代码示例流程图案例分析,让你既能轻松应对面试,又能真正理解Zookeeper的“底层逻辑”。

一、背景介绍:为什么Zookeeper是大数据开发者的“必考题”?

1.1 Zookeeper的“江湖地位”

想象一下:在一个大型工厂里,有几百台机器(分布式服务)需要协同工作——有的负责生产(计算),有的负责运输(存储),有的负责质检(监控)。如果没有一个“调度中心”,这些机器会各自为政,导致混乱(比如重复生产、数据不一致)。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值